Well, having a look at the Mail::SPF::Query package, I'm not sure it is working
correctly at all.

I downloaded the http://www.schlitt.net/spf/tests/ "SPF Test Suite", and 
EVERY test failed - not one test was successful - even after editing the
tests to fix the broken '-sanitize=1 and -debug=1' spfquery arguments.
Test log attached.

Hence, it appears Mail::SPF::Query is not up to the job - removing it :
  $ rpm -e perl-Mail-SPF-Query
will resolve this bug.
